What if you, as an ordinary person, had the opportunity to invest in a startup you loved, just like angel investors do? Wefunder is a platform that enables these opportunities, and today’s guest, Jonny Price, VP of fundraising at the platform, joins us to share some insights into how it all works. We talk about the benefits of this model of crowdfunding, both for investors and for founders. Not only does it democratize the space, but companies then have a built-in army of loyal followers. Disruptive technology that can work to distribute wealth is going to be a gamechanger in our increasingly unequal society, and with a company like Wefunder leading the charge, we are excited to see where this movement will go.
